Bruck-Mürzzuschlag is a district in Styria, Austria. It came into effect on January 1, 2013, by merging of the districts of Bruck an der Mur and Mürzzuschlag.[1] Just 2 years later, on 1 January 2015, the district was restructured in the Styria municipal structural reform and reduced from 37 to 19 towns. It consists of the following 19 municipalities:[2]






  • Aflenz

  • Breitenau am Hochlantsch

  • Bruck an der Mur

  • Kapfenberg

  • Kindberg

  • Krieglach

  • Langenwang


  • Mariazell

  • Mürzzuschlag

  • Neuberg an der Mürz

  • Pernegg an der Mur

  • Sankt Barbara im Mürztal


  • Sankt Lorenzen im Mürztal       



  • Sankt Marein im Mürztal       

  • Spital am Semmering

  • Stanz im Mürztal

  • Thörl

  • Tragöß-Sankt Katharein

  • Turnau


Prior district before 2015


Up until 1 January 2015, the district contained the following 37 municipalities:






  • Aflenz Kurort

  • Aflenz Land

  • Allerheiligen im Mürztal

  • Altenberg an der Rax


  • Breitenau am Hochlantsch        

  • Bruck an der Mur

  • Etmißl

  • Frauenberg

  • Ganz

  • Gußwerk

  • Halltal

  • Kapellen

  • Kapfenberg


  • Kindberg

  • Krieglach

  • Langenwang

  • Mariazell

  • Mitterdorf im Mürztal

  • Mürzhofen

  • Mürzsteg

  • Mürzzuschlag

  • Neuberg an der Mürz

  • Oberaich

  • Parschlug


  • Pernegg an der Mur              


  • Sankt Ilgen

  • Sankt Katharein an der Laming

  • Sankt Lorenzen im Mürztal

  • Sankt Marein im Mürztal

  • Sankt Sebastian

  • Spital am Semmering

  • Stanz im Mürztal

  • Thörl

  • Tragöß

  • Turnau

  • Veitsch

  • Wartberg im Mürztal
